Labor and employment legislation might be managed at both the government or the state degree. It covers a lot of ground including; kid labor, FMLA, government/ government agreements, medical care strategies, retired life, safety and security standards, and work permission for immigrants.
In many of Arizona, the minimum wage that can be paid to a worker is $10.50 an hour. All workers are qualified to make the full minimal wage established by state or federal law, regardless of whether they are qualified to ideas.
Employers are called for to supply overtime pay to nonexempt employees who are covered by the FLSA. That consists of hourly workers and even some salaried staff members.
Under Arizona regulation, when an employer hires an independent service provider, they should safeguard the designation of an independent contractor by having the employee authorize an affirmation of independent organization standing. Discrimination can be an infraction of government and state legislation. Under Title VII of the Civil Legal right Act, workers are shielded from discrimination based upon their sex, race, color, national origin, or faith if the employer has 15 or even more workers.
They additionally may not segregate or otherwise identify a worker to reject them work opportunities or to or else influence their standing as a staff member. One more kind of discrimination in the workplace is sexual discrimination. The Equal Pay Act of 1963 is a government law that says employers may not discriminate against employees (including what they're paid) based upon the employee's gender.
Workers that are 40 years of age or older are safeguarded from being victimized in employing, shooting, or withholding of a task promo. Individuals with handicaps are additionally shielded under a number of government laws when it pertains to work. It is taken into consideration discrimination to produce qualifications just for the objective of invalidating someone with a special needs.

Annually employers in the United States underpay their workers by billions of bucks. The majority of American employees are qualified to be paid (1) base pay which is currently $7.25 per hour, and (2) overtimes earnings of one-and-one-half times their regular per hour price. Functioning off the clock, consisting of over lunch or after hours, is generally prohibited.
While numerous staff members are thought about tipped workers and are paid $2.13 per hour, overall compensation should be at least $7.25 per hour, including pointers. Additionally, employers must pay tipped workers $5.12 rather of $2.13 or $3.20 when functioning overtime.
Staff members can additionally take personal clinical leave for their very own serious clinical condition. Companies can not strike back against workers who are seeking leave, have taken leave, or are returning from leave.
Under the Americans with Disabilities Act ("ADA") an employer should provide a handicapped worker with sensible holiday accommodations. if it would certainly allow the staff member to do the essential functions of the work. Practical accommodations could consist of, customizing work schedules, short term leave, working from home, or readjusting task responsibilities.
